The $2.1 billion, 225,000-member Redwood Credit Union in Santa Rosa, Calif., said it is now accepting contributions to the American Red Cross for Hurricane Sandy relief.

Contributions are being accepted at the credit union's branches and can be made via cash deposit, direct funds transfer or checks payable to the Red Cross.

"Our hearts go out to everyone who has been affected by this disaster," said Brett Martinez, RCU President/CEO.
